now, Thursday were heavily influenced by the emo scene considering they played shows with You And I, Saetia, Neil Perry. IMO, i could say they are an emo influenced post-hardcore band. eventually, thursday got big, and some of bands with similar audio traits were lumped in with them. the fact that Taking Back Sunday ended up on victory didn't help either. someone probably used emo to describe thrusday, and some magazine or internet writer got a hold of the word and exploited it to death because it's catchy. is that right? i dunno, just testing out if it really works. |
